Cage spends New Year's Eve in a small pub – and gets everyone a drink
US actor Nicolas Cage stunned regulars at a small Somerset pub by spending New Year’s Eve there – and buying them all a drink.
The Oscar winner, 55, was a “total legend” and a “cool dude”, one local, Koink, said on Reddit.
He posted: “Nicolas Cage spent NYE in my small, local pub, in Somerset. He bought everyone a drink.”
A photo shows Cage behind the bar of the Tramways Social Club, while in another, he is seen posing for a selfie.
“Our newest member, Nicolas Cage,” the club posted on its Facebook page.
Membership is £10 a year, and half that for pensioners, the club says on its website.
It was recently “refurbished and brought up to a modern high standard of finish and comfort”.
Posting on the Facebook page, one reveller described Cage as a “legend”, saying it was “so kind of him to have bought us all a drink”.
Lorraine Barrett, who got the selfie, posted: “Happy new year Nicolas Cage, thank you for making a small club happy by your presence. You are now a member of the Tramways.”
The star reportedly has a house in Baltonsborough, near Glastonbury, and used to live in Bath, where he turned on the city’s Christmas lights in 2009.
Cage won his Academy Award, in addition to a Golden Globe and Screen Actors’ Guild Award, for his role as an alcoholic Hollywood writer in Leaving Las Vegas.
He has also appeared in Face/Off, Con Air, and City Of Angels.
